The term "ladyboy" often refers to individuals who are born male but identify as female or non-binary, commonly found in various Asian cultures. In some countries, the concept of ladyboys, or kathoeys, has been a part of traditional and modern societies. However, the understanding and treatment of these individuals vary significantly across different cultures and regions.

Before diving deeper, it's essential to understand the terminology used to refer to individuals who identify as female or non-binary despite being born male. The term "ladyboy" is often used in Southeast Asia, particularly in Thailand, to describe kathoeys or trans women. However, some individuals prefer to be referred to as "transgender," "trans women," or simply by their preferred names. The term "ladyboy" often refers to individuals who

In Thailand, the local term is kathoey . It is an umbrella term for trans women or gender non-conforming people and is deeply rooted in Thai history.
